Web28 jul. 2024 · Exercise can help reduce stress, as can activities like yoga, deep breathing, and meditation. 4. Recognize underlying issues. Addiction rarely happens without warning. If you have an online chatting addiction, try to figure out what underlying stressors may be fueling your need for constant online contact.
